ANNEX 1 - MANDATORY CONDITIONS
(1) The first condition is that no supply of alcohol may be made under the premises licence: -
(a) At a time when there is no designated premises supervisor in respect of the premises licence, or
(b) At a time when the designated premises supervisor does not hold a personal licence or his personal licence is suspended.
(2) The second condition is that every supply of alcohol under the premises licence must be made or authorised by a person who holds a personal licence.
EMBEDDED CONDITIONS
Permitted Hours
Alcohol shall not be sold or supplied except during permitted hours. In this condition, permitted hours means:
a) On weekdays, other than Christmas Day, 8am to 11pm.
b) On Sundays, other than Christmas Day 10am to 10.30pm.
c) On Christmas Day, 12 noon to 3pm and 7pm to 10.30pm.
d) On Good Friday 8am to 10.30pm.
Restrictions
The above restrictions do not prohibit:
a) during the first twenty minutes after the above hours, the taking of the alcohol from the premises, unless the alcohol is supplied or taken in an open vessel:
b) the ordering of alcohol to be consumed off the premises, or the despatch by the vendor of the alcohol so ordered:
c) the sale of alcohol to a trader or club for the purposes of the trade or club:
d) the sale or supply of alcohol to any canteen or mess, being a canteen in which the sale or supply of alcohol is carried out under the authority of the secretary of state or an authorised mess of members of Her Majesty's naval, military or air forces.
2. Alcohol shall not be sold in an open container or be consumed in the licensed premises.
3. Credit sales
Alcohol shall not be sold or supplied unless it is paid for before or at the time when it is sold or supplied, except alcohol sold or supplied to a canteen or mess.
